      <abstract>The Geographic Names Information System (GNIS) is the Federal standard for geographic nomenclature. The U.S. Geological Survey developed the GNIS for the U.S. Board on Geographic Names, a Federal inter-agency body chartered by public law to maintain uniform feature name usage throughout the Government and to promulgate standard names to the public. The GNIS is the official repository of domestic geographic names data; the official vehicle for geographic names use by all departments of the Federal Government; and the source for applying geographic names to Federal electronic and printed products of all types.       <purpose>The Geographic Names Information System contains information about physical and cultural geographic features of all types in the United States, associated areas, and Antarctica, current and historical, but not including roads and highways. The database holds the Federally recognized name of each feature and defines the feature location by state, county, USGS topographic map, and geographic coordinates. Other attributes include names or spellings other than the official name, feature designations, feature classification, historical and descriptive information, and for some categories the geometric boundaries. The database assigns a unique, permanent feature identifier, the Feature ID, as a standard Federal key for accessing, integrating, or reconciling feature data from multiple data sets. The GNIS collects data from a broad program of partnerships with Federal, State, and local government agencies and other authorized contributors. The GNIS provides data to all levels of government and to the public, as well as to numerous applications through a web query site, web map and feature services, file download services, and customized files upon request.</purpose>
      <supplinf>The U.S. Board on Geographic Names was created in 1890 and established in its present form by Public Law in 1947 to establish and maintain uniform geographic name usage throughout the Federal Government. The Board serves all government agencies and the public as the central authority to which name inquiries, name issues, and new name proposals can be directed. It is comprised of representatives of Federal agencies associated with land management and cartography. Sharing its responsibilities with the Secretary of the Interior, the Board develops principles, policies, and procedures governing the use of both domestic and foreign geographic names as well as undersea and Antarctic feature names.</supplinf>

During Phase I data compilation, a random sample of 10% of the entries in the system were visually verified against the compilation source data (large-scale USGS topographic maps) to ensure logical consistency of locative references (geographic coordinates, topographic map, and county. Subsequent data compilation and input processes include programmed validation checks for logical consistency, visual examination, and spot checks of data.</logic>
    <complete>This dataset contains information about United States physical and cultural geographic features of all types and classes, with the exception of most roads and highways. Subsequent to the original data compilation process, which was taken primarily from Federal maps, the GNIS has become dependent on input from Federal, State, county, and local government agencies and other approved sources. The completeness, currency, and accuracy of the data varies by area depending on the quality and timeliness of that input. Accordingly, the Geographic Names Project actively seeks to expand partnerships with Government agencies at all levels and other interested organizations. The latest tools and methodologies are being applied, including web map and feature services, and joint or linked web applications, to ensure that local data are properly represented in the GNIS and through the GNIS to all Federal agencies and to the public. Feature additions or corrections are accepted for consideration from any source, and when validated by appropriate agencies, will be entered into the database. Local and State agencies are encouraged to submit data and to participate in the GNIS partnership program. Non-government organizations with valuable data are considered on a case basis. Authorized partners have access to web based transaction entry and edit forms, which submit data directly to the GNIS for review and inclusion in the database. Partners also submit batch files in most standard formats, and coordinate with the Geographic Names Project to develop joint services, processes, and applications for greatest efficiency. Data entered into the GNIS immediately is available to all web services and applications dependent on it.         <attrdef>A permanent, unique number assigned to a geographic feature for the sole purpose of uniquely identifying that feature as a record in any information system database, dataset, file, or document and for distinguishing it from all other feature records so identified. The number is assigned sequentially (highest existing number plus one) to new records as they are created in the Geographic Names Information System. The number, by design, carries no information or association to the content of the feature record and therefore is not subject to change as attribute values change. Once assigned to a feature, the number is never changed or withdrawn, and never reassigned. The Feature ID can be applied in conjunction with system-unique record identifiers in any database or system, thus providing a national standard common reference identifier across multiple datasets. The Feature ID is stored in the GNIS database as an integer with a maximum of ten digits.</attrdef>

        <attrdef>A geographic feature name and its written form and application approved or recognized as official by the United States Board on Geographic Names for use throughout the Federal Government. The official name is established either by policy or by decision of the Board on Geographic Names. It is the proper name, specific term, or expression by which a particular geographic entity is, or was, known. A geographic feature may have only one official name, which must be the name applied to the feature on all Federal products, electronic or printed.</attrdef>

        <attrdef>A feature class is a designation for a group of features in a broadly defined descriptive category. All features are assigned to one and only one class. They do not individually classify all kinds of cultural and natural features. By design, there are no Federal or industry standards or guidelines for feature classification. These classifications originally were developed for mainframe file structure search purposes. Although the terms are generally consistent with dictionary definitions, they may not conform exactly and are not always intuitive.</attrdef>

        <attrdef>Elevation in meters: The elevation above sea level of the feature at the primary point (positive number) or depth of a feature at the lowest point below sea level (negative number). By default, elevations are provided in meters. For custom data extracts, elevations can be provided in either feet or meters depending on user requirements. Elevation figures are not official and do not represent precisely measured or surveyed values. The data are extracted from the National Elevation Dataset (http://ned.usgs.gov/) for the primary coordinates and may differ from elevations cited in other sources. The differences will be most evident for features such as summits where precision is of more concern and where the local relief (rate of change of elevation) may be more prominent. However, the elevation figures are within tolerances for the data for most points and sufficiently accurate for purposes of general information.</attrdef>

Topical extracts of the data base are also available: the U.S. Populated Places File lists information about all communities throughout the United States that are described in the database; the U.S. Concise File lists information about major physical and cultural features throughout the United States that are described in the database; the Historical Features File lists information about features which are no longer in existence and/or no longer serve their original purpose; the All Names File lists all names, both official and nonofficial (variant), for all features in the nation; and the Antarctica File contains entries throughout the continent of Antarctica as approved for use by the United States Government.
